Optimal hybrid push/pull control strategies for a parallel multistage system: Part I

Abstract

A multistage production/inventory system is modelled. The system structure, which has the form of an assembly network, is abstracted from the production process of a typical integrated iron and steel works. The system is modelled as a Markov Decision Process (MDP). Combinations of Just-In-Time (pull) and MRP (push) policies are used as alternatives in the MDP. Optimal hybrid strategies are developed. In part II, we extend our observations to a more general case.
